
Piotr Tchaikovsky was a
Russian composer. He was born in Votkinsk, Russia on May 7, 1840. Even
though he was Russian he was raised by a French governess. At age six
he started playing the piano. When he was eight he was sent to boarding
school. Now we covered his younger years, lets begin his older years.
At age 19 he
completed his law studies. As you know he was a composer. Some of
things he composed are The Nutcracker, Romeo and Juliet, Swan Lake, and
Sleeping Beauty. In 1891 he traveled to America to introduce his music.
It became very popular. He usually wrote romantic ballets and music. He
died Cholera in St. Petersburg on Novemeber 6, 1893. He was a great
composer.
